Output 82a609c21478f689bb5ec966ced41febdd9dbfe38079e732a8fefe9875ba7910:0

value
1025848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2a6e0814a3e4e6a655ebb749bccda5ba4c9e1a7 OP_EQUAL
address
3LtqjeGw1EbDE6FfFMYAt1Yq8dk3YUYDeC
transaction
82a609c21478f689bb5ec966ced41febdd9dbfe38079e732a8fefe9875ba7910
confirmations
308881
spent
true